Creativity workshops are fundamentally designed to stimulate innovative thinking and encourage participants to think outside conventional boundaries. They focus on generating a wide range of ideas and concepts, making creativity the central theme of the workshop. This approach allows participants to explore and develop new solutions, which can later manifest in various forms such as business strategies, product ideas, or innovative marketing tactics.

The emphasis on concept generation in these workshops fosters an environment where individuals can brainstorm freely, collaborate, and build upon each other's ideas. This collective ideation process is essential for cultivating a culture of creativity within teams or organizations, and it often serves as the precursor to actionable outcomes like product development or branding strategies. Recognizing the significance of creativity highlights the workshops' primary goal—fueling the imaginative process that ultimately leads to new concepts and innovations.
